Encryption
We’ve already mentioned data encryption and, in general terms, how it works in the context of SSH connectivity. But the need to protect the integrity of your data goes well beyond remote login sessions. You should consider encrypting your data just about wherever you store or consume it. Whether or not your particular use cases and privacy needs justify the effort, AWS provides a number of enterprise-strength encryption tools that are conveniently and effectively integrated into relevant services.
Encryption keys—the data files used to control an object’s cryptographic transformation—are mostly managed on AWS by the AWS Key Management Service (KMS). When you select to encrypt an AWS resource, KMS will apply encryption using a customer master key (CMK) that’s been generated especially for your account. You can manage your keys—including creating new keys or scheduling the deletion of old ones—through either the KMS Dashboard...